Anybody had their buttons stop working and solved the problem?

I’ve been running Project Justice on the Dreamcast using two Brook retro boards. Today the punch and kick buttons stopped working but the joystick and start buttons still function.

I checked all the inputs on a CPS 2 board and used a regular DC controller to make sure it wasn’t the ports. Any advice?

Have you tried redoing your button map on the JAMMAizer? It's possible for the EEPROM storage inside of the microcontroller to become corrupted if there was a power supply brown out or some other power related issue. If the EEPROM was corrupted then the buttonmap you had stored would be lost and you'd need to program it again.

What controller board were you using? I found the MC Cthulhu covered most things, but also used the Akishop PS360+ sometimes.
 
I did note some weird compatibility issues between the two controller boards I used. So switched between them. Mainly issues with PlayStation and multiple players. The older consoles generally worked a treat.

Worth trying some other controller boards if you have ability to. I didn’t use a Brooks but they seem to have a good reputation as stable.

I did have some badly crimped cables. One that fried my SNES and another that did weird shit to my NES. So make sure your cables are ok. I ended up crimping my own because the ones I had made could not be trusted even though they were from one of the most reputable cable guys.
